Lu handed Alex a small notebook. "This contains the real guide to acing system design interviews. It's not just about memorizing patterns and techniques; it's about understanding the underlying principles and thinking creatively."
This brings us back to the idea of a "patch." The term also applies to the conceptual evolution a candidate needs to undergo when using these books. While they are brilliant resources, treating them as a simple answer key to be memorized is a common and costly mistake.
If you cannot afford the book, buy a one-month subscription to O'Reilly Online Learning ($49). You get access to System Design Interview – Volumes 1 & 2 plus hundreds of other books. You can highlight and download temporary PDF chapters.
Many engineers are unaware that the journey doesn't end with the first volume. Alex Xu also authored , which delves into more complex modern topics (like real-time messaging platforms and advanced database patterns). If you are aiming for Senior (L5/E5) roles or beyond, the second volume is often considered essential, as it provides the depth required for harder follow-up questions. alex lu system design interview pdf patched
Use the diagrams in the guide to create scenarios for peer-to-peer interviews.
Zooming into specific bottlenecks, data schemas, and optimization algorithms.
The search modifier "patched" usually suggests a modified or updated version of a digital file. When applied to this specific PDF, it could refer to several possibilities: Lu handed Alex a small notebook
The diagrams are exceptionally clear, making abstract concepts like sharding, replication, and load balancing easy to visualize. Understanding the "Patched" or "Updated" Search
A core reason candidates seek out Alex Xu's material is his structured approach to highly ambiguous, open-ended interview questions. Using this 4-step framework helps candidates avoid diving straight into deep technical implementations without understanding the core problem. Step 1: Understand the Problem and Establish Scope
However, a specific search term has been trending lately: Whether it's a misspelling of "Alex Xu" or a search for specific updated content, it highlights a major trend in tech prep—the desperate search for the most current, "patched," or updated versions of these high-stakes study materials. Why the Obsession with Alex Xu’s Guides? While they are brilliant resources, treating them as
Develop a rough block diagram showcasing the API gateway, load balancers, web servers, and database layer.
Unofficial PDFs rarely contain the actual, up-to-date "patches" or revisions provided by the author in the official ecosystem.
: Engineering candidates often bookmark collaborative repositories where peers annotate or correct open-source system design roadmaps. Core Architectural Pillars in Modern System Design
System design interviews are typically used to assess candidates for senior software engineering positions, technical lead roles, or architecture positions. The interview process usually involves a series of questions that test the candidate's knowledge of system design principles, scalability, performance, and reliability.
If you need a from Alex Xu’s work (without infringing copyright), let me know – I can provide original study notes instead.